Check out sleeve expansion anchors for lighter weights. If you’re hanging a heavy mirror on drywall without the support of a stud, you need drywall anchors that can bear the weight of your mirror. Make sure to add the screws into the wall stud or use a drywall anchor to ensure it holds in place and use more than one to hang a heavy mirror. Installing a screw into a wall stud is the most secure way to hang a heavy mirror. A detailed visual guide and necessary measurements are included. They’re the obvious solution of how to hang a heavy mirror on drywall. The best way to hang a very heavy mirror is to drive screws directly through the mirror's frame, into wall studs. An alternative is to use a metal cleat system, where a cleat on the frame and a cleat on the wall interlock to hold the mirror. Use a winged anchor designed to hold the weight (or more) of your large mirror. In that case, you can.
